Transaction 2863bf3054d3002238fb8170caa83049390f5675130b1564fc76177228d52795
1 Input
1 Output
-
2863bf3054d3002238fb8170caa83049390f5675130b1564fc76177228d52795:0
- value
- 1186766
- script pubkey
- OP_0 OP_PUSHBYTES_20 a4d3de7d1629e3ce05bc31ea51ec73027d817a2d
- address
- bc1q5nfaulgk983uupdux849rmrnqf7cz73d8karma